Abstract

The invention provides a protocol state machine automatic inference method based on state fusion. The method comprises the following steps of message format extraction, message classification, session abstraction and original state machine construction and the state fusion based on output messages. An extended prefix tree transducer EPTT is adopted in the protocol state machine automatic inference method to describe the session process of a protocol entity, the output messages of a protocol are focused on, the same states in a state machine are fused, testability interaction is carried out on the protocol entity to verify the feasibility of protocol state fusion, the automation of the inference of the protocol state machine is guaranteed, and the accuracy of an inference result is improved.

Description

technical field [0001] The invention relates to the field of network technology, in particular to a method for automatically inferring a protocol state machine of a corresponding network protocol based on network messages received and sent by a protocol entity program. Background technique [0002] Network protocols are the supporting elements for the realization of network communication functions, and are also key research objects in the field of network security. A large number of network security technologies such as intrusion detection, fuzz testing, protocol reuse, and protocol vulnerability analysis are based on detailed protocol specification information. [0003] A large number of private protocols lacking description documents are used in the network, which greatly limits the application range of various network security technologies that rely on information specifications.
